Why Early Childhood Matters
The early years of a child's life are a once-in-a-lifetime window of development. More than 90% of brain growth happens before age 5, and the foundation laid during these years shapes everything from emotional regulation and learning capacity to social confidence and identity.

How ReadyPlay™ Compares to Other Preschool/Daycare Models
| Feature | ReadyPlay™ | Traditional Daycare | Montessori | Reggio Emilia | Bank Street | Waldorf |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Ages Served | 2–6 | 2–6 | 0–6 | 2.5–6 | 3–6 | 3–6 |
| Academic Readiness | Play-based, embedded skills (math, writing, literacy) | Not prioritized | Indirect | Emergent | Project-based | Delayed until age 7 |
| SEL Development | Daily block, journaling, recognition system | Varies widely | Implied | Reflective | Group-focused | Emphasized through rhythm & storytelling |
| Creativity | Daily Creative Sparks block, child-led expression | Often minimal | Structured materials | Artistic core | Integrated | Core of curriculum |
| Leadership & Communication | Daily opportunities: greeter, helper, speaker, teacher | Rarely emphasized | Through self-direction | Through collaboration | Group roles | Modeled via story and group dynamic |
| Mixed-Age Grouping | Yes, with intentional groupings and teacher roles | Common but unstructured | yes | yes | yes | yes |
| Teacher Approach | Attuned coach with structured facilitation | Supervisor/caregiver | Guide | Co-learner | Observer/scaffold | Long-term relationship model |
| Curriculum Type | Proprietary structured-flexible model | Care routine-focused | Self-paced | Emergent | Integrated | Rhythmic, artistic, nature-based |
| Parent Communication | Biannual growth reports, initial baseline assessment, family check-ins as needed | Basic updates | Portfolio-based | Documentation panels | Narrative reports | Limited; focus on home-school harmony |
| Daily Structure | Predictable rhythm with flexible participation | Varies greatly | Structured independence | Emergent rhythm | Flexible schedules | Strong rhythm and repetition |
| Real-World Skills | Public speaking, leadership, cultural awareness | Minimal | Practical life skills | Expression-focused | Contextualized learning | Minimal early focus |
| Child Autonomy | Structured choices within safe parameters | Often unstructured | High autonomy | Child-led inquiry | Supported choices | Guided within rhythmic flow |
| Assessment & Growth Tracking | Baseline intake + 6-month reviews with learning evidence | Limited or none | Observational notes | Visual documentation | Narrative with goals | Minimal assessment |
| Family Involvement | Biannual updates, photos, SEL reflections | Pickup-only updates | Occasional conferences | Family displays | Progress reports | Emphasis on home-life balance |
